It happens: They just happen in many cases. Some run in families (genetic). Symptoms can be from growth of the tumor or irritation of nerves and other structures nearby. Sometimes they are found when the bone breaks for bone weakness from the tumor. In other cases they are found when a person is evaluated for another problem.
